Sat 1507696918101664

decimal
393078.1918101664
degree
0°183078′1974″1918101664‴
percentile
71.79509141714911%
name
debhqanfxrl
cycle
0
epoch
1
period
194
block
393078
offset
1918101664
timestamp
rarity
common
inscriptions
location
226f278bc6d7ff5f0f62a5cf9552d5d57850ee17f9bf918751ffb56a3642315d:0:0
address
bc1pcqy7kmsgl5yzv5wvhh5tyqtjzshzvqauskpfclhvq3a2madrx8psd6927f